NV.UA: 186 Ukrainian workers arrived in Poland on two planes

The owner of the Gremi Personal employment agency, which organised the charters, noted that arranging two flights was a necessity because of Polish regulations on the number of people on board. However, the company chose not to give up on the charters in order to diligently meet its commitments to Polish businesses and the Ukrainians with whom long-term contracts had been signed.
